Angry I think I blew my turbo! :(

So I got my new boost controller in and wanted to install it. I do have a defi boost gauge so I could measure the psi. After installing the controller took it out for a drive. I floored it and the car spiked all the way up to 18psi. I immediately pulled over and turned the boost way down, I got the boost to sit at a constant 12-13psi. I did a 40 roll and went up to 4th gear, then all of a sudden I hear a boom.

Then white and blue smoke where pouring out from the exhaust, the engine basically acted like the time my turbo gasket went out and had no boost build up. I took the intake off and felt the compressor wheel and it does have a bit of movement too

The odd thing about it is that my down pipe now is blown(literally) it has holes in it closer to the turbo, i dont know what brand of downpipe it was came with my car,

I was wondering what everyones opinions are about this? let me know what you guys think or agree with me.
